Today, we are sharing with you a wedding video of a beautiful couple in Santorini. After the romantic wedding proposal, the sweet couple traveled with friends and family to Santorini for their unforgettable wedding! “A lot of people told me how quickly the day would go, and that it would be over within a flash. I decided that a video would be fantastic for us to have something to never forget. Our day was the most amazing day of our lives. We had 69 amazing family and friends come over with us, and we wanted every moment captured”, the bride shared with us! Lose yourself in the magic of this wonderful video!

 

“We went to high school together and got together aged 15. We have grown up with the same friends whom of most we remain very best friends with. All my friends used to say every year, that’s it he’s proposing this year, he’s proposing this holiday, at Christmas and it went on and on for years. I always knew he would do it when I least expected it and he sure did. Our little girl Imogen was born on the 17th January 2015; she was beautiful and we kissed her the moment she was born. Dave and the midwives took her to her cot to get her nappy on and cleaned up. They handed her back to me, Dave unwrapped the blanket and Imogen was there with a little pink ribbon attached to her wrist with my ring dangling from it. I was totally gob smacked, he then asked me to marry him. The best moment of your wedding was when my dad clenched my hand and walked me down the aisle. I saw Dave standing at the end and I thought ‘wow I’m going to marry my best friend’. My hairs stood on end hearing the saxophone playing thousand years by Christina Perri, it was just so perfect. My dad kissed me and let me go”.

“Our video is amazing. Alex Stabasopoulos really understood the style we wanted. I wanted to capture the emotion, but also the fun we had. We also wanted to capture the best moments of the day, as our children are aged 9 and 2 and we wanted something for them to be able to watch when they are older. I asked Alex to make sure he got lots of footage of the children and he never missed a second. The children are our world and to spend the day with them was incredible.. I researched a couple of videographers and after much thought we decided Alex and his team could create something that we would love. He didn’t let us down. He added in our favorite songs and put them so well into the editing. Our guests commented on how they didn’t notice them. They weren’t in our faces, it didn’t feel like they were following us around, it was really relaxed, it was just how we wanted it”.
